How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 79.79 against 24.24 in East African Community (EAC), a difference of 55.55.
That makes Tunisia's figure about 3.3 times East African Community (EAC)'s.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Tunisia has been ahead every year.
East African Community (EAC) ranks 51st and Tunisia ranks 51st of 61 groups.
Tunisia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| East African Community (EAC) |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 18.5 | 54.32 | 35.83 | Tunisia |
| 2010s | 21.25 | 68.86 | 47.61 | Tunisia |
| 2020s | 23.49 | 78.43 | 54.93 | Tunisia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
